Step-by-step explanation:

242 is a composite number.

Prime factorization: 242 = 2 x 11 x 11, which can be written 2 x (11^2)

The exponents in the prime factorization are 1 and 2. Adding one to each and multiplying we get (1 + 1)(2 + 1) = 2 x 3 = 6. Therefore 242 has 6 factors.

Factors of 242: 1, 2, 11, 22, 121, 242

Factor pairs: 242 = 1 x 242, 2 x 121, or 11 x 22

Taking the factor pair with the largest square number factor, we get √242 = (√2)(√121) = 11√2 ≈ 15.556
